The NHS provides a variety of excellent services however, it can be a challenge for people with ADHD get a referral. There are often waiting lists and the NHS isn't able to respond immediately to the request for an ADHD evaluation. Many people are choosing to pay for private ADHD assessment.

The ADDNI charity has revealed that some health trusts have refused to accept new referrals of adults for ADHD tests. Patients are now being forced to take out loans and face financial hardship. Others are turning to private companies, such as the Irish ADHD/ASD clinic to receive an assessment.

The ADHD assessment process integrates data from a variety of sources, including medical history and behavioral data. The process may also include interviews with teachers or family members (particularly for children) to assess how symptoms impact their academic performance. This is done to rule out any other illnesses that could be causing similar symptoms. The final diagnosis is based on the results of the aforementioned processes and in line with NICE guidelines.
